Los Angeles Master Chorale Presents WADE IN THE WATER, 4/30

The Los Angeles Master Chorale puts spirituals at the forefront of a concert called “Wade in the Water” to be performed at Walt Disney Concert Hall on Sunday, April 30 at 7 PM. The concert features 13 songs with the spirituals juxtaposed with other folk music traditions such as early American shape note singing, as well as a contemporary Korean piece, and a pair of European choral masterpieces from the 20th century. The concert will feature 48 singers performing a cappella, conducted by Artistic Director Grant Gershon and Assistant Conductor Jenny Wong. The concert also provides an opportunity to highlight several of the Master Chorale's solo voices on the program.

LA Master Chorale to Perform Minimalist Masterworks at Disney Hall, 4/6

The Los Angeles Master Chorale (LAMC), heralded around the globe for its exceptional artistry and wide ranging repertoire, showcases 'Minimalist Masterworks,' featuring works by celebrated American composers Steve Reich and David Lang, on Sunday, April 6, 2014, 7 pm, at Walt Disney Concert Hall. The concert opens with Perotin's Sederunt principes featuring tenor soloists Pablo Cora, Michael Lichtenauer and Shawn Kirchner. The Chorale then reprises Reich's You Are (Variations), commissioned, premiered and recorded by the Chorale in 2004 (Nonesuch), and Lang's Pulitzer Prize-winning the little match girl passion, of which LAMC presented an extended choral version last season hailed as 'a performance to remember' (Outwest Arts). ListenUp!, a pre-concert talk with Gershon and KUSC's Alan Chapman, is slated for 6 pm, in BP Hall. The concert is part of the second installment of the Los Angeles Philharmonic's citywide, multi-disciplinary Minimalist Jukebox Festival, curated by composer John Adams.

LA Master Chorale's FESTIVAL OF CAROLS Set for Disney Hall, 12/7 & 14

The Los Angeles Master Chorale (LAMC) heralds Christmas with two matinee performances of its delightful seasonal concert, "Festival of Carols," Saturday, December 7, 2013, 2 pm, and Saturday, December 14, 2013, 2 pm, at Disney Hall. Silent Night, Hark the Herald Angels Sing, White Christmas, Deck the Hall and Santa Claus is Coming to Town are among the cherished holiday carols and traditional favorites setting a joyous mood and sung to glorious perfection by 115 members of the Chorale under Music Director Grant Gershon's baton. Also featured are the world premieres of arrangements by LAMC Swan Family Composer In Residence Shawn Kirchner - the French carol Pat-a-Pan, which he has intricately layered for women's voices and describes as "rhythmic and vibrant," and the Czech Rocking Carol, a lullaby setting for men's voices he calls "tender and soothing." Pianist Lisa Edwards and organist John West, who performs on Disney Hall's iconic pipe organ, add a delightful sonic flourish to the concert.

Benefit Cosmetics Opens First San Francisco Store in 25 Years

Benefit Cosmetics, the LVMH Moët Hennessy Louis Vuitton-owned cosmetics brand, opened a 1,300-square-foot boutique at 262 Sutter Street in downtown San Francisco. It's been about 25 years since they opened a store in the West Coast city and 37 years since Benefit founders Jean and Jane Ford set up shop at The Face Place in San Francisco's Mission District.
